Blackshear is too strong for Gapare and Tafara is very foul prone. When a player is having a game like blackshear was last night there's not a lot you can do. Trying to deny him the ball is very difficult. Blackshear is a 5th year senior (grad student). I think his sister said he is 23.0
Blackshear played very well and we were not going to "shut him down" but I think there were other things we could have done rather than just watch him repeatedly play bully ball with Reeves. Nevada spread the floor and went ISO ball with Blackshear - no threat from over 15 feet or so - just back into the lane bump Reeves back a step and shoot a fadeaway. Lather rinse repeat.

Options - go big and make it difficult for him to go bully ball or at least give him some concern on his shots. Gapare to me is the best option but pick anyone 6'9 or so. You could even go with Ndongo but given his fouls probably not.

Go zone and have 2 guys at the line to stop the backdown. Con is that you have to have someone stay with Lucas which is an issue. But no one else was going to beat us.

Commit to early help from Kelly who was guarding Foster or McIntosh. Make Blackshear pick up the ball and see if Foster/McIntosh can beat us. Key is make someone else beat us.

The other part to be honest though would be to make a shot. 6-26 from 3 and 38% from the floor puts way too much pressure on the defense.
